一种标识解析方法和装置制造方法及图纸

技术编号:33498440 阅读:60 留言:0更新日期:2022-05-19 01:09
本申请提供了一种标识解析方法和装置,其中,该方法包括:SRv6网关节点接收用户的标识解析请求,其中,所述标识解析请求中携带有用于承载标识信息的简化标识表述选项;对所述简化标识表述选项进行解析,确定标识类型和标识值;根据标识类型确定进行解析的SRv6节点;根据所述标识解析请求的目的地址,结合沿途进行解析的SRv6节点,确定SRv6传输策略;在SRv6策略中封装标识类型、标识值、SRv6传输策略,并标记进行解析的SRv6节点,得到封装后的SRv6策略;传送封装后的SRv6策略,以在传输的过程中,进行随路解析,得到标识解析结果。通过上述方案解决了现有的多样化标识所存在的索引开销过大、时延过大的问题,达到了有效减少索引开销、降低时延的技术效果。降低时延的技术效果。降低时延的技术效果。

【技术实现步骤摘要】
一种标识解析方法和装置


[0001]本申请属于电数字数据处理
,尤其涉及一种标识解析方法和装置。

技术介绍

[0002]域名系统(Domain Name Server,DNS)是因特网中的一项核心服务,是用于实现互联网域名和IP地址相互映射的一个分布式数据库,用于将互联网域名与IP地址进行绑定,使得用户能够通过方便记忆的字符代替IP地址访问互联网提供的资源和服务。通过主机名,得到该主机名对应的IP地址的过程叫做域名解析。现有的DNS无法满足工业互联网场景下对于“物”的解析需求,因此,针对不同的场景,提出了不同的标识解析方法,其中,使用较为广泛的是Handle与BID。
[0003]由于Handle与BID等均是面向工业场景与物联网场景,Handle与BID均具有与DNS不同的解析逻辑。即Handle与BID均具有单一无意义标识进行标识请求发起,标识结构化字段较少,而具有较为复杂的返回消息。DNS则是具有较为灵活的解析请求消息类型,例如A记录,AAA记录,CNAME与URL等。因此,在未来的网络中,将会存在多样化的解析请求。
...

【技术保护点】

【技术特征摘要】
1.一种标识解析方法,其特征在于,所述方法包括:SRv6网关节点接收用户的标识解析请求,其中,所述标识解析请求中携带有用于承载标识信息的简化标识表述选项;对所述简化标识表述选项进行解析,确定标识类型和标识值;根据标识类型确定进行解析的SRv6节点;根据所述标识解析请求的目的地址,结合沿途进行解析的SRv6节点,确定SRv6传输策略;在SRv6策略中封装标识类型、标识值、SRv6传输策略,并标记进行解析的SRv6节点,得到封装后的SRv6策略;传送封装后的SRv6策略,以在传输的过程中,进行随路解析,得到标识解析结果。2.根据权利要求1所述的方法,其特征在于,传送封装后的SRv6策略,以在传输的过程中,进行随路解析,得到标识解析结果,包括:SRv6的中间节点在处理对应的本地SID时,解析SID中的FUNCT字段;确定FUNCT字段是否存在随路解析指令,如果存在,则读取标识值进行解析;如果解析成功,则返回解析结果,并中止传输;如果解析失败,则按照SRv6策略继续传输。3.根据权利要求2所述的方法,其特征在于,确定FUNCT字段是否存在随路解析指令,如果存在,则读取标识值进行解析,包括:读取SID中的FUNCT字段;确定FUNCT字段是否为Res;如果是Res,则确定存在随路解析指令。4.根据权利要求1所述的方法,其特征在于,所述简化标识表述选项为定长定序的表述字段,所述简化标识表述选项包括如下字段:8字节的下一报头,用于表示下一报文头的编号;8字节的报头扩展长度,用于表示本报文头的长度;8字节的标识类型,用于表示标识类型;8字节的保留字段;256字节的结构化标识,用于对标识信息进行简化承载;32字节的填充字段。5.根据权利要求1所述的方法,其特征在于,标识类型包括以下至少之一:DNS、handle和BID。6.根据权利要求1所述的方法,其特征在于,根据标识类型确定进行解析的SRv6节点包括:调取预设的标识类型规则,其中,预设的标识类型规则表示标识类型与SRv6节点的对应关系;根据预设的标识类型规则和标识类型,确定进行解析的SRv6节点。...

【专利技术属性】
技术研发人员:吴畏虹刘江王冰清黄韬
申请(专利权)人:北京邮电大学
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1